Higher demand for immunity boosting spices like turmeric has helped the nation in reporting a 19 per cent growth in export of spices and spice products during the first half of the year, state-run Spice Board of India said. Agri commodity exchange NCDEX formally announced on Sunday the launch of Options in Goods contracts on wheat, rapeseed-mustard seed and maize from July 27. The tool entails compulsory delivery settlement after expiry or freedom to sell in the open market if the market rate is higher than the contracted price. The new tool is slated […]
India has been importing oilseeds more aggressively than exporting it. As per the government data for past four years, oilseeds imports to India have jumped 226 per cent as against 14 per cent dip in exports. Wheat production during the current rabi season could be a record 113.66 million tonnes, nearly 10 per cent more than the 103.6 million tonnes output in the previous year, while gram output could be 8 per cent higher at 10.74 million tonnes, according to the crop estimate report released by private weather forecasting firm Skymet. The government has so far purchased around 1.34 lakh tonnes of pulses and nearly 30,000 tonnes of oilseeds from farmers worth Rs 785 crore during the ongoing marketing season of rabi (winter) crops. The National Bulk Handling Corporation (NBHC), which has come out with its first rabi crop estimates for 2019-20, said the total rabi cereals production for 2019-20 is expected to increase by 4.52 per cent to 1,342.3 lakh tonnes from 1,284.3 lakh tonnes in 2018-19. In what is being termed as the biggest locust swarm attack in over two decades, several parts of North Gujarat have seen crops like castor, cumin and mustard take a major hit. Total area sown with winter crops (Rabi) in India reached at 251 lakh hectares so far, about 10 per cent lower than the 276.83 lakh hectares planted in the corresponding week last year.
